Abstract
The utility model discloses a kind of connection component for motor compressor and the motor compressor with it, connection component includes:Electric-controlled plate, glass terminal, connection terminal and connection box, glass terminal have binding post;One end of connection terminal is electrically connected with electric-controlled plate, and the other end of connection terminal is provided with connecting hole;Connection box is located on electric-controlled plate, is formed with holding tank in connection box, the other end of connection terminal is stretched into holding tank, and binding post is stretched into connecting hole through connection box and electrically connected with connection terminal.According to the connection component of the present utility model for motor compressor, by setting connection terminal in connection component, and one end of connection terminal is electrically connected with electric-controlled plate, the other end of connection terminal is electrically connected with glass terminal, hereby it is achieved that the electrical connection between glass terminal and electric-controlled plate, eliminating is used for the lead-out wire for connecting glass terminal on electric-controlled plate in correlation technique, simplify the structure and assembly technology of connection component, it is easy to process and efficiency of assembling is high.

Background technology
The electric-control system of motor compressor such as vehicle mounted electric compressor is often placed in inside compressor, and motor part and
Electric control part is accommodated in different spaces respectively, and glass terminal connects motor section and electric control part as connection member.
In correlation technique, lead-out wire is generally connect on electric-controlled plate, then lead-out wire is connected with binding post, then by wiring
Terminal insertion connection box, is connected, complicated, efficiency of assembling is low finally by terminal box with glass terminal.

The connection component for motor compressor 200 according to the utility model embodiment is stated below with reference to Fig. 1-Fig. 4
100.Wherein, connection component 100 can be arranged on the housing of motor compressor 200.
Such as Fig. 1 and Fig. 3 shows, according to the connection group for motor compressor 200 of the utility model first aspect embodiment
Part 100, including:Electric-controlled plate 1, glass terminal 2, connection terminal 3 and connection box 4.Wherein, glass terminal 2 can respectively with compression
The motor section (not shown) and electric-controlled plate 1 of machine are electrically connected.
Specifically, glass terminal 2 has binding post 21.One end (for example, left end in Fig. 3) of connection terminal 3 directly with
Electric-controlled plate 1 is electrically connected, and the other end (for example, right-hand member in Fig. 3) of connection terminal 3 is provided with connecting hole 34.Connection box 4 is located at automatically controlled
On plate 1, holding tank 41 is formed with connection box 4, the above-mentioned other end of connection terminal 3 is stretched into holding tank 41, and binding post 21 is worn
Connection box 4 is crossed to stretch into connecting hole 34 and electrically connect with connection terminal 3.Alternatively, binding post 21 can be stretched into through connection box 4
Directly electrically connect in connecting hole 34 and with connection terminal 3.It is simple in construction, it is easy to connect.
Alternatively, binding post 21 can be formed as cylindrical shape, and the cross section of binding post 21 can be formed as circular, connection
Hole 34 can be formed as square through hole.Binding post 21 stretch into connecting hole 34 and binding post 21 outer peripheral face and connecting hole 34
Inwall is contacted.Thus, it is easy to binding post 21 being directly connected electrically on connection terminal 3, it is simple in construction, it is easy to connect.
According to some embodiments of the present utility model, binding post 21 is interference fitted with connecting hole 34.Thus, it is possible to ensure to connect
The outer peripheral face of terminal 21 is in close contact with the inwall of connecting hole 34, so that between binding post 21 and connection terminal 3
Connection is more reliable and more stable.
Specifically, above-mentioned one end of connection terminal 3 is provided with linkage section 32, and linkage section 32 extends towards electric-controlled plate 1, linkage section
32 are suitable to be connected with electric-controlled plate 1.Alternatively, connection terminal 3 can be formed as L-shaped or be formed generally as L-shaped.For example, referring to
Fig. 3 simultaneously combines Fig. 4, and electric-controlled plate 1 is located at the lower section of connection terminal 3.Connection terminal 3 can include main part 31, and main part 31 can
To be formed as the platy structure of strip, linkage section 32 is connected and extended downwardly with the left end of main part 31.Linkage section 32 and master
Body portion 31 is formed generally as L-shaped.Thus, it is easy to linkage section 32 to be connected with electric-controlled plate 1, and it is simple in construction, it is easy to process.
Alternatively, linkage section 32 is welded on electric-controlled plate 1.For example, referring to Fig. 3, the free end of linkage section 32 is (for example, Fig. 3
In lower end) can be welded through electric-controlled plate 1 with electric-controlled plate 1.Thus, it is possible to which connection terminal 3 is securely connected into electric-controlled plate 1
On, and directly connection terminal 3 can be connected electrically on electric-controlled plate 1, eliminating is used for what is electrically connected in traditional connection component
Lead-out wire etc..Technique is simple, easy to process.
According to some embodiments of the present utility model, the above-mentioned other end of connection terminal 3 is provided with plug division 33, plug division 33
It is plugged in holding tank 41, connecting hole 34 is formed on the bottom wall of plug division 33.For example, referring to Fig. 3 and Fig. 4 is combined, connection end
The right-hand member of son 3 is provided with plug division 33, the open at one end of holding tank 41, in order to which plug division 33 is plugged on the holding tank of connection box 4
In 41.Alternatively, plug division 33 can be formed as the frame structure of one end open, opening direction and the linkage section 32 of plug division 33
Bearing of trend it is opposite.For example, in the example of fig. 4, the cross section of plug division 33 is formed generally as " u "-shaped.Plug division 33
Opening direction is upward.Thus, it is possible to which connection terminal 3 is plugged in connection box 4 by plug division 33 so that connection terminal 3 is consolidated
It is scheduled on connection box 4.
Connecting hole 34 is formed on the bottom wall of plug division 33, and binding post 21 can be stretched into connecting hole 34 through connection box 4
And electrically connected with connection terminal 3.Thus, it is possible to which binding post 21 is located in connection box 4, the peace of connection component 100 is improved
Full property and reliability.
Alternatively, connection box 4 is insulating part.
Further, the side (for example, right side in Fig. 4) of the remote linkage section 32 of plug division 33 is provided with two elastic cards
Piece 35, two elastic cards 35 are located at the opposite sides (for example, front side and rear side in Fig. 4) of connection terminal 3 respectively, and remote
On direction from connection terminal 3, two elastic cards 35 are respectively facing direction extension away from each other.Alternatively, two elasticity
The distance between free end (for example, upper end in Fig. 4) of card 35 is A, and the width of plug division 33 is B, and A, B are met:A > B.
Thus, after plug division 33 is plugged in holding tank 41, two elastic cards 35 can respectively with the front side wall of holding tank 41 and
Rear wall stop to so that plug division 33 can be stuck in holding tank 41, prevent plug division 33 from deviating from from holding tank 41 so that even
More stablize the position of connecting terminal 3.
According to some embodiments of the present utility model, reference picture 1 simultaneously combines Fig. 2, and holding tank 41 includes the communicated with each other
One receiving portion 411 and the second receiving portion 412, the open at one end of the first receiving portion 411, the other end of the first receiving portion 411 and
Two receiving portions 412 are connected.First receiving portion 411 is suitable to accommodate plug division 33, and the second receiving portion 412 is suitable to accommodate elastic card
35.Alternatively, the width of the first receiving portion 411 is less than the width of the second receiving portion 412, and the second receiving portion 412 and first is accommodated
Cascaded surface 42 is formed between portion 411.Elastic card 35 is stretched into after the second receiving portion 412, the adjacent stepchain face 42 of elastic card 35
A side surface and cascaded surface 42 only support.Thus, it is easy to plug division 33 being plugged in the first receiving portion 411, and can causes
Elastic card 35 is stuck in the second receiving portion 412, so as to further prevent connection terminal 3 from deviating from from holding tank 41 so that
More stablize the position of connection terminal 3.
According to some embodiments of the present utility model, glass terminal 2 and connection terminal 3 are respectively multiple, such as three.
Multiple glass terminals 2 are corresponded with multiple connection terminals 3, are formed with connection box 4 multiple one-to-one with connection terminal 3
Holding tank 41.
